Apr 10, · Drought ranks second in terms of national weather-related economic impacts, with annual losses nearing $9 billion per year in the U.S. [] Beyond direct economic impacts, drought can threaten drinking water supplies and ecosystems, and can even contribute to increased food faburrito.com the last decade, drought conditions have hit the Southeastern US, the Midwest, and the Western US In
